SCHRAM, Elizabeth "Beth" nee FLANSCHE nee VanBOGART 1908 - 2001

HAWKEYE — Elizabeth cSchram, 93, died Saturday, Oct. 20, 2001 at the Good Samaritan Nursing Center, High West Union after a short illness.

Funeral services were held at 10:30 a.m. Tuesday, Oct. 23 at Peace United Church of Christ, Fredericksburg with Pastor Joan Fumetti and Pastor Roger White presiding. Organist was Yvonne Lienau and ianist was Shelley Mohling. soloist was Keith Kreun. Special music was “There's Something About That Name", "His Hand In Mine" and "Thy Will Be Done".

Interment was in Rose Hill Cemetery, Fredericksburg with Richard Johnson, Ron Knutson, Richard Weidemann, Jack Schult, Bill Elliott and Glen Boie as casket bearers. Flower Committee was Diane Johnson, Sondra Elliott and Marcia Schult.

Visitation was from 5 to 8 .m. Monday, Oct. 22 at ecker-Milnes Funeral Home, Hawkeye, and for one hour preceding services at the church on Tuesday.

Elizabeth "Beth" was born Aug. 5, 1908 in Hawkeye, the daughter of Frank and Charlotte "Lottie" (Fish) Van Bogart. She was baptized and confirmed at St. John Lutheran church Sumner Beth attended Bethel Township Country  School and Hawkeye High School. She was united in marriage  with Art Flansche. They later divorced. Beth then married Oliver Schram on Aug. 10, 1972 at his farm north of Hawkeye. Prior to her marriage to Oliver, Beth worked at the Sunrise Guest Home and Meinerz Creamery in Fredericksburg. She was a member of the Hawkeye United Methodist Church and Ladies Aid and the Hawkeye Garden Club. She enjoyed gardening, bowling, arranging flowers and baking and watching sports.

Survivors include one son, Robert "Butch" (Susan) Flansche, New Hampton; four daughters, Maxine (Ward) Kuhlman, Howell, MI, Jean (Larry) Whiteford, Sparks, NV, Helen (Gary) Schulz and Faye (Terry) Elliott, Fredericksburg; one daughter-in-law, Mildred Clark; 24 grandchildren; 32 great-grandchildren; three great-great-grandsons; two sisters-in-law, Mavis Van Bogart, Apache Junction, AZ and Blythe Van Bogart, Hawkeye and Oliver's extended family.

Preceding her in death were her husbands; one son, Howard Flansche, in 1961; two daughters, Betty Flansche, in infancy and Lucy Leyh, in 1981; five brothers, Lionel, Alonzo, Charles, Ervin and Bernel Van Bogart and three sisters, Rhea Van Bogart, Olive Mayo and Mignon Martin.

Source: New Hampton Tribune; Oct. 26, 2001 Page 4
